summaryrefslogtreecommitdiffstats
path: root/lld/lib/ReaderWriter/ELF/X86/X86ELFReader.h
diff options
context:
space:
mode:
authorRui Ueyama <ruiu@google.com>2015-04-02 06:00:42 +0000
committerRui Ueyama <ruiu@google.com>2015-04-02 06:00:42 +0000
commit0a1fbb7b0c9984bc6e515cad70e919d30be10047 (patch)
tree5926982f04ab60ea3a10c52d0bbe5b906d9f2500 /lld/lib/ReaderWriter/ELF/X86/X86ELFReader.h
parent2f50744fe723b48389ed1f30e8f3e73217a66f9e (diff)
downloadbcm5719-llvm-0a1fbb7b0c9984bc6e515cad70e919d30be10047.tar.gz
bcm5719-llvm-0a1fbb7b0c9984bc6e515cad70e919d30be10047.zip
ELF: Replace empty classes with typedefs.
llvm-svn: 233896
Diffstat (limited to 'lld/lib/ReaderWriter/ELF/X86/X86ELFReader.h')
-rw-r--r--lld/lib/ReaderWriter/ELF/X86/X86ELFReader.h18
1 files changed, 3 insertions, 15 deletions
diff --git a/lld/lib/ReaderWriter/ELF/X86/X86ELFReader.h b/lld/lib/ReaderWriter/ELF/X86/X86ELFReader.h
index 8cb15a84230..d1ec697776b 100644
--- a/lld/lib/ReaderWriter/ELF/X86/X86ELFReader.h
+++ b/lld/lib/ReaderWriter/ELF/X86/X86ELFReader.h
@@ -28,21 +28,9 @@ struct X86ELFFileCreateELFTraits {
}
};
-class X86ELFObjectReader
- : public ELFObjectReader<X86ELFType, X86ELFFileCreateELFTraits,
- X86LinkingContext> {
-public:
- X86ELFObjectReader(X86LinkingContext &ctx)
- : ELFObjectReader<X86ELFType, X86ELFFileCreateELFTraits,
- X86LinkingContext>(ctx) {}
-};
-
-class X86ELFDSOReader
- : public ELFDSOReader<X86ELFType, X86LinkingContext> {
-public:
- X86ELFDSOReader(X86LinkingContext &ctx)
- : ELFDSOReader<X86ELFType, X86LinkingContext>(ctx) {}
-};
+typedef ELFObjectReader<X86ELFType, X86ELFFileCreateELFTraits,
+ X86LinkingContext> X86ELFObjectReader;
+typedef ELFDSOReader<X86ELFType, X86LinkingContext> X86ELFDSOReader;
} // namespace elf
} // namespace lld
OpenPOWER on IntegriCloud